Better get used to the feel... An overstable disc will just hide the wobble out of your hand if you can't rip your Pure cleanly. Good for short term; long term however you'll probably want to figure out the Pure.
 
The Chief and Shaman are the only ones I've used that were noticeably shallower than the Pure in the hand... Of the two, I prefer the Chief.

I would say a Chief OS is better because my Chiefs all have had some turn and light fade. Scales are amazing too because no glide makes it easy to range. Chief or Chief OS are both great for low profile.

Chief OS works well on Roc type lines that flip up to flat and have some fade. The chief goes nuts straight on a flat release and breaks into a great slow turning driving putter.
